Berks County Montessori Country Day School

Berks County Montessori Country Day School in Reading, PA, serves 136 students from pre–kindergarten through 8th grade in a rural community setting.
Founded in 1968, this nonsectarian Montessori school employs 8 teachers for a student–teacher ratio of 17:1.
The school's enrollment includes a student body with 22% students of color, reflecting some diversity within its rural locale.
As a Montessori program, it offers co–educational early learning and elementary education without religious affiliation.
Compared to other Reading private schools serving similar grades, Berks County Montessori maintains a moderate enrollment size and student–teacher ratio.
